Medical Assistant Salary in Cannon Beach, OR — Complete Guide

Median Salary Overview

The median salary for a medical assistant in Cannon Beach, OR is $52,152 per year, adjusted for the local cost of living index of 115. This figure reflects typical earnings for experienced professionals in this role, considering Cannon Beach's unique economic conditions.

Salary Range and Experience Levels

Entry-level medical assistant professionals in Cannon Beach can expect to earn around $37,929 annually. As professionals gain experience, salaries typically increase, with senior-level medical assistants earning approximately $70,440 per year. This represents a 86% increase from entry to senior level.

Cost of Living Adjustment

Cannon Beach's cost of living index of 115 significantly impacts salary comparisons. As a higher cost-of-living city, salaries in Cannon Beach are adjusted accordingly. This means that while the nominal salary may appear higher or lower than the national average of $45,350, the actual purchasing power must be considered in context.

Housing and Affordability

A significant portion of a medical assistant's salary in Cannon Beach typically goes toward housing. With a 1-bedroom apartment averaging $1,400 per month, housing represents about 32.2% of median salary. Financial experts generally recommend keeping housing expenses below 30% of gross income.

Career Growth and Opportunities

Medical Assistants are in growing demand across the United States, with an expected job growth of 13% over the next decade. In Cannon Beach, this translates to increasing opportunities and potential for salary growth as demand for experienced professionals continues to rise.
